How to fill out request for proposals

01
Step 1: Start by clearly defining the purpose of the request for proposals (RFP). Identify the specific needs or requirements that the RFP should address.
02
Step 2: Create a detailed document outlining all the necessary information for potential vendors to understand the project or service. Include the scope of work, desired outcomes, timeline, evaluation criteria, and any other relevant specifications or conditions.
03
Step 3: Develop a list of potential vendors or bidders who might be interested in submitting proposals. Conduct market research or use a pre-qualified vendor list to ensure you reach out to qualified suppliers.
04
Step 4: Publish the RFP document in appropriate channels such as your organization's website, a procurement portal, or industry-specific platforms. Provide a clear deadline for proposal submissions.
05
Step 5: Organize a pre-proposal conference or meeting to address any questions or concerns from potential vendors. This can help clarify the requirements and level the playing field for all participants.
06
Step 6: Evaluate the received proposals based on the predetermined criteria. This can involve reviewing the vendors' qualifications, experience, pricing, references, and overall fit with the project.
07
Step 7: Select the vendor who best meets the requirements and negotiate the terms and conditions of the contract.
08
Step 8: Notify all vendors about the outcome, thanking them for their participation and providing feedback if possible.
09
Step 9: Finalize the contract and proceed with the agreed-upon project or service implementation.
10
Step 10: Maintain good communication and monitor the progress of the vendor to ensure successful completion of the project.

Who needs request for proposals?

01
Request for proposals are typically needed by organizations or businesses looking to procure goods or services from external vendors.
02
Government agencies often utilize RFPs when they require specific projects, construction, or services.
03
Large corporations or enterprises may use RFPs to find qualified suppliers for various needs like technology, consulting, or manufacturing.
04
Non-profit organizations or NGOs may issue RFPs to identify partners or contractors for their initiatives or programs.
05
Any organization seeking to explore the market and obtain competitive bids can benefit from using a request for proposals.

Request for proposals (RFP) is a document that solicits proposal, often made through a bidding process, by an agency or company interested in procurement of a commodity, service, or valuable asset, to potential suppliers to submit business proposals.
RFPs are usually required to be filed by government agencies, corporations, and other organizations looking to obtain goods or services through a competitive bidding process.
To fill out a request for proposals, one typically needs to follow the guidelines outlined in the RFP document provided by the issuing organization and submit a proposal that meets the specified requirements and criteria.
The purpose of a request for proposals is to enable organizations to compare different proposals from potential vendors and select the best one that meets their needs and requirements.
The information required on a request for proposals may vary, but typically includes details about the project or service being requested, evaluation criteria, submission requirements, deadlines, and contact information.
